Kathleen Cochran: A Mother's Journey Through Addiction and Advocacy

Episode Overview

  • Kathleen's 18-year journey supporting her daughter through substance use disorder
  • Advocating for harm reduction and individualized paths to recovery
  • Challenges of finding effective treatment and the stigma surrounding addiction
  • The importance of educating oneself and understanding there isn't a one-size-fits-all approach to recovery
  • The need for more accessible resources and the impact of harm reduction
The anecdote for powerlessness is education.
Meet Kathleen Cochran, a mother who has spent 18 years navigating the tumultuous waters of her daughter's substance use disorder. In this heartfelt episode, Kathleen opens up about her personal journey, sharing the highs and lows of supporting a loved one through addiction. She is the founder of Heart of a Warrior Woman and the Facebook group Moms for All Paths to Recovery (MAP), platforms dedicated to helping mothers find their way through similar struggles.
Kathleen champions harm reduction and believes in individualized paths to recovery, emphasizing that there is no one-size-fits-all solution. She talks candidly about the challenges of finding effective treatment, battling stigma, and the crucial need for accessible resources. Kathleen's story is a testament to the power of community support and education, offering hope and practical advice for families facing similar battles.
Whether you're a parent dealing with a child's addiction or someone looking to understand more about harm reduction, this episode provides valuable insights and real-world experiences that resonate deeply.
